Harmonia: Journal of Research and Education
ISSN : 25412426     EISSN : -     DOI : 10.15294
Core Subject : Education, Art,
Harmonia: Journal of Arts Research and Education is published by Departement of Drama, Dance, and Music, Faculty of Language and Arts, Universitas Negeri Semarang in cooperation with Asosiasi Profesi Pendidik Sendratasik Indonesia (AP2SENI)/The Association of Profession for Indonesian Sendratasik Educators, two times a years. The journal has focus: Research, comprises scholarly reports that enhance knowledge regarding art in general, performing art, and art education. This may include articles that report results of quantitative or qualitative research studies.

Positive Paradigm As The Barrier of Art Creativity Interpretation

Abstract

In the modern era, during the end of 17 century, appears empiric paradigm in the philosophy field. This paradigm emerges due to the critic towards mythical social thought. The next step appears positivism thought by Auguste Comte in 1830, which stated that Sociology based on science analogy that can be learned in the form of empiric data with exact calculation; out of this is rated as not scientific. The education field also trails the modern thought tradition, along with Comte’s positivistic thought. This modern era eventually has been opposed by postmodern philosophers. The frailties in the modern era are criticized by the appearance of the postmodern paradigm. Positivistic thought, in reality, could not reveal study beyond human and society, because this study is strong, and can only reach the ontologic stage, in substance of the object. While this could not be revealed because its level involves human and society’s way of thinking, primordial, tradition, and historical aspects, this study focuses on the weaknesses of positivistic research. Then it will present post-positivistic-postmodern research through Hermeneutika and Foucauldian Genealogy research.

Music And Language: A Stress Analysis of English Song Lyrics

Abstract

Music especially a song has a stress pattern of musical rhythm. In the first bar, there is a strong beat called accent. Like a music, English is often described as stress-time language. There some rules of the language in pronunciation.  The purpose of this study is to know the tendency English stress pattern applied in English song lyrics viewed from the stress pattern of music rhythm. This study is a quantitative one by using musical approach. Sample of this study uses two song analysis is used. And to discuss the finding analysis the musical approach especially music composition is applied. The results of this study are (1) most of the syllables of English stress pattern are matched to the stress pattern of the musical rhythm in which have different meter signature, 78.15 % in Song 1 and 97.31 % in Song 2. (2) most word classes whose s syllables of word stresses are matched to the stress pattern of musical rhythm are nouns, 52,27 % in Song 1 and 67.27 % in Song 2. Based on the result suggestions in this study are that it is important for composers to consider to the two important elements of the English song, lyric and beats or meter signature, to get good song, and other study related to this study are needed in order that this finding can be generalized to all of English song Lyrics
Musical Activity in The Music Learning Process Through Children Songs in Primary School Level

Abstract

This study aims to analyze and describe the musical activity in the process of learning music through children songs in primary school. A qualitative approach in this research is made by focusing on the field research method. Data were collected by observation techniques, interviews, and documentation studies. Data analysis was done by following certain stages respectively, i.e. data collection, data reduction, data display, conclusion drawing, and verification. The results showed that musical activities implemented in three primary schools consist of (1) listening to music; (2) singing; (3) playing musical instruments; (4) moving to follow the music; and (5) reading music. However, forms, types, and variations of the musical activities taking place in these schools are different, depending on the schools’ policy, schools’ abilities, and music teachers’ abilities in teaching the music subject.
REOG AS MEANS OF STUDENTS’ APPRECIATION AND CREATION IN ARTS AND CULTURE BASED ON THE LOCAL WISDOM Ambarwangi, Sri; Suharto, Suharto

Abstract

This paper is the result of the study and the implementation of learning in the field of the author, especially in the implementation of the study of Arts and Culture in the vocational schools. Thepurpose of this paper is to show that by learning local culture based on learning objectives the corresponding to the curriculum can be reached. In fact, the local culture also containing more local wisdom is felt directly by the students. The art of Reog, known around Pringapus Semarang Regency, can be used as a means of learning arts for students, especially in the activities of appreciation and expressions. The existing values in the art of Reog can be conceptually presented in class, as well as directly through the students’ activities of appreciation and expression in theform of performances in the school environment. Students can easily receive learning materials and can be more expressive while presenting the show. The values that are in the presentation of the art of Reog are social, religion, nationalism, and culture. Students can present Reog with enthusiasm and expressive as a show that has already exist for a long time in the environment of their own, and even many have become the performers of Reog in their neighborhood. Reog has already been part of his life that has the role of self-actualization, expression, social, and cultural. Most of those students feel proud to be a part in the show in his living quarters so that they do not feel ashamed of serving the art in school.

REOG KEMASAN SEBAG AIASET PARIWISATA UNGGULAN KABUPATEN PONOROGO (The Packes Reog as the high tourism ofPonorogo residence)

Abstract

Reog merupakan kesenian rakyat Ponorogo yang berkembang di beberapa wilayah terutamadi Jawa Timur, Jawa Tengah dan Daerah khusus ibukota Jakarta. Reog sebagai seni kemasanpariwisata mulai digelar pada festival Reog tingkat Nasional dalam serangkaian GrebegSuro pada tahun 1980 di Ponorogo. Reog dikemas secara ringkas dan padat agar dalamwaktu pementasan yang singkat, gerak dimodifikasi, kualitas mutunya tetap terjamin dapatmemuaskan selera wisatawan. Seluruh penari Reog menjadi pemegang peran, sehinggadapat menarik penonton. Tari Warok, Dhadhak Merak, Bujangganong, Jathtt dan KlanaTopeng melakukan kreatifitas gerak tari sesuai dengan keahlian senimannya, sehinggamemberikan nuansa baru. Sebagai seni kemasan Reog merupakan tiruan dari aslinya, relatifkaya gerak dan singkat dalam arti waktu pertunjukan relatif pendek, penuh variasi,mengesampingkan nilai sakral, magis serta simbolis dan relatif murah harganya.Kata kunci: Pariwisata, kemasan, Reog Ponorogo.
Model Pembelajaran Musik Angklung Sunda Kreasi di Sanggar Saung Angklung Udjo Nglagena, Padasuka Bandung Jawa Barat. (Model Study of Music Angklung Creation in Gallery of Saung Angklung Udjo Ngalagena Padasuka Bandung West Java)

Abstract

Udjo Ngalagena [UN] dan Sanggar Saung Angklung Udjo Ngalagena [SAUN]merupakan pelaku budaya yang berperan dalam upaya melestarikan danmengembangkan jenis-jenis musik angklung. Sosok Udjo Ngalagena merupakanfigur pribadi dan institusi yang aktif dalam proses transformasi musik angklung darifungsi seni yang berfungsi untuk upacara ritual yang berhubungan dengan paninpadi, kemudian menjadi seni hiburan dan totonan. Berbagai upaya kreatif dilakukanoleh Udjo Ngalagena maupun bersama sanggar-nya, dari mulai; [1] kerjaeksperimentasi bentuk jenis-jenis musik yang terbuat dari bambu khususnya musikangklung, [2] model pembelajaran yang menggunakan sitem nomor, danmenggunakan simbol gerak tangan, hingga terbentuk inovasi musik angklung, yangkemudian dikenal dengan musik angklung Sunda kreasi Udjo. Sanggar SaungAngklung UN yang merupakan pembaharu jenis musik angklung telah menjadikanmusik angklung sebagai bentuk musik pertunjukan yang bisa setiap saatdipentaskan bahkan hampir setiap hari selalu mementaskannya terutama bilakedatangan para tamu dari mancanegara maupun tamu domestik yang berkunjung.Kata Kunci : Udjo Ngalagena, model pembelajaran, Angklung Sunda Kreasi.
